We all know that Madonna and Steve are like this (I'm crossing my fingers), so it is no surprise that she agreed to have her entire catalog of music made available on the iTunes Music Store. This includes her latest effort, 'Confessions On a Dance Floor,' which I have not had the pleasure of listening to. However, it is available on the iTMS in two versions, the normal album with a number of tracks and the 'non-stop mix' version (both of those links will open the iTMS). The non-stop mix consists of the entire album as one track with no pauses in between the songs, so you can dance, dance, dance. The track is a little over 56 minutes long, and will cost you $12.99 (the cost of the deluxe album which includes a bonus track and a digital booklet).
